您的位置:首页 > 其它

git的基本操作

2018-03-07 23:17 183 查看
新上手一个项目,难免会忘记git的一些操作指令,于是趁现在工作不是很忙,自己便整理一下git的一些基本指令。

git拉取远程数据,并建立新的分支

git clone [url]

克隆远程仓库代码

git pull

获取并合并其他的厂库,或者本地的其他分支。拉取远程到本地

git branch

列出本地已经存在的分支,并且在当前分支的前面用”*”标记

git checkout -b web

创建并切换分支名字为web的分支上;注意此时最后面的蓝色的括号的内容应为web,而不是master

git 代码提交到远程主机

思路:每个项目都有自己的子分支,先将代码在子分支上提交,然后到主分支上和子分支代码合并,上传到远程,最后再切换回来子分支


git status

列出了(修改过的、新创建的、已经暂存但未提交的)文件,若有更改过的会有红色的文件列出来。

git add . (注意add+空格 + 英文点)

将修改添加至本地缓存

git commit -m ‘备注’

将本地缓存保存到本地仓库中

git checkout master

切换到master分支

git pull

获取并合并其他的厂库,或者本地的其他分支。拉取远程到本地

git checkout 【子分支】

切换回子分支

git rebase master

合并另外一个分支的内容,但是会把本分支的commits顶到最顶端

git checkout master

切换到master分支

git merge 【子分支】

将子分支的内容和主分支的内容合并

git push

将合并后的代码提交到远程(此时在master分支上)

git checkout 【子分支】

最后切换回子分支

git一些常用的指令

git diff        //用于比较两次修改的差异
git remote -v   //列出远程库的名字
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签:  git